WebSo the ordering in terms of strength of IMFs, and thus boiling points, is CH3CH2CH3 &lt; CH3OCH3 &lt; CH3CH2OH. The boiling point of propane is −42.1 °C, the boiling point of dimethylether is −24.8 °C, and the boiling point of ethanol is 78.5 °C.
